What drugs are associated with warm autoimmune hemolytic anemia. Of these, which drugs are associated with haptens? Which drugs generate autoantibodies?
Penicillin and quinidine are hapten forming. Alpha methyl dopa generates autoantibodies.
What test is positive in warm autoantibody disease?
Direct antiglobulin(Coombs) test
Cold autoimmune hemolytic disease has an acute and chronic form. What infections are associated with the acute form. What type of neoplasm is associated with the chronic form.
Acute form is associated with mycoplasma pneumoniae and infectious mononucleosis(Epstein Barr virus(EBV). Chronic form is associated with lymphoid neoplasms.

How is the autoantibody in Grave's disease different from other autoantibodies?
The autoantibody in Grave's disease, thyroid stimulating immunoglobulin(TSI), actually binds and activates the TSH receptor.
